Research Interest
Bioelectrochemical sensors; materials electrochemistry; electrochemiluminescence; nano materials and devices Research areas related to electrochemical (biological) sensors, materials, electrochemical, electrochemiluminescence, chip laboratories. In the country to carry out the earliest temperature modulation electrode (thermal electrode) research work. In the interface electrochemical, temperature modulation of the basic theory of electrochemical and its application has made important research results. At the international level for the first time for the semiconductor three-dimensional packaging technology to achieve high aspect ratio through-hole (TSV) plating. The patented technology is currently used in the most advanced packaging process. Since 2001, six National Natural Science Fund projects have been obtained and hosted. Access to national authorized invention patents 10, published more than 40 papers SCI. Including Chem Eur-J, Chem Commun, Biosens Bioelectron, Green Chem, J Mater Chem and other internationally renowned journals. Published in Chem Commun on the hot electrode on the treatment of avian flu precursor (shikimic acid) high sensitivity detection of the paper, was selected as a hot article (Hot Article), and by the British Royal Journal of Chemical Technology as a bright spot.
